What is Medicine 2.0?
Medicine 2.0 applications, services and tools are Web-based services
for health care consumers, caregivers, patients, health
professionals, and biomedical researchers, that use Web 2.0
technologies as well as semantic web and virtual reality tools, to
enable and facilitate specifically social networking, participation,
apomediation, collaboration, and openness within and between these
user groups.
